Yes, there is the weird glue smell; yes, it can look cakey if you don't apply it correctly... BUT, when done right, this is the most wonderful drugstore foundation. I have very oily, very acne-prone and acne-ridden skin. This foundation is absolutely fantastic for my face. It does not break me out, it stays put all day long but doesn't sink into the lines of my face. I am very pale, but the lightest color Ivory is not the best match for me. It's too pink, and turns my face orange. Buff, on the other hand, blends in with my skin tone perfectly and provides wonderful coverage. All my pitted acne scars on my cheeks are smoothed over, my complexion is brightened and I only need a tiny bit of setting powder to have a smooth, clear face. LOVE this product, will continue to buy, for sure.
Oh yes, one more thing - I've used a MILLION different eyeshadow primers. I own everything from Urban Decay to ELF, BE, Mac, etc. etc. etc. Nothing sets my eyes better for eyeshadow that this foundation. Not even anything remotely close to a crease all day long, and I have some seriously oily lids. Love it.

Having combination/oily skin, I have been afraid of liquid foundations for as long as I can remember. I always thought they would feel heavy, oxidize, and eventually just make me look like a hot oily mess. For a while I was using the Smashbox BB cream which I really did like but I didn't like the price tag. Then I switched to the Bare Minerals Matte foundation and I liked that too but I would get a lot of residue coming off and it didn't quite give me the desired coverage. I heard great reviews about this and decided to give it a try! My store had no testers so I was really lucky that I ended up buying the perfect shade. Let me just say, I am so impressed! This foundation goes on nicely (I I use a stippling brush/kabuki brush) and once dry, leaves a really nice matte and even look. I'd say it has medium coverage which is just enough for me as I don't have a lot of blemishes. With the BM, I used to get an oily sheen even noon, but with this, I find that I don't ever really have to touch up because it does such a good job of keeping me matte all day. I don't get a lot of residue coming off which means it definitely has amazing staying powder. It is a little on the pricier side for a drugstore foundation, but it sure beats the $35+ dollars I was paying before. Plus, a little goes a long way so a bottle will last me a few months at least. My only complaint is the packaging; I hate that you have to pour it out and wish it had a pump instead but I can deal because it makes up for it in quality. I think I have found a new HG foundation and in the drugstore at that! So thoroughly impressed.

With all the hot weather my makeup was melting off in no time so I thought this would be the perfect time to try Revlon's colorstay foundation. I tried the combination to oily formula since it is summer in the color medium beige. I have combination skin that leans dry but also oily at the same time. I was shocked at how well this product performs! It really does stay on 24 hours plus without budging and that is nearly impossible on my skin. The finish is full coverage and covered everything I needed to camoflauge on my face. I have been using MUFE HD foundation and still need concealer to cover some spots so it was refreshing not having to add this step to my foundation routine. Colorstay was easy to apply and left a flawless finish that looked amazing. Never did I have lines or streaks from it fading during the day or night. The only problem I had with this is it was too drying for my face even though it's oily. My face started to dry out after a few days of use which made lines on my face more pronounced and flakes appear so that is the only reason I would not repurchase. I was pleased with the product in general so I will be checking out the normal to dry formula to see if it works better for me. I would recommend this formula to anyone who has a super oily skin....not so much for those with dry/normal/or even combination skin.
This is a fantastic foundation! I have very oily skin, with large pores and an acne problem (with acne marks), and this is a great foundation at dealing with all those problems. It has incredible staying power, and gives a very full coverage.
It has got a strong smell, but you get used to it. It also dries rather quick, so you have to work fast or work in sections on the face. I find it's best applied with a foundation brush. In Australia this retails at $37 full price, which is pretty expensive, but if you stock up when it's on sale, you're all set. Besides, I don't mind paying more for something that I know works, and it lasts a fair while too. I found my last bottle lasted about 3 months and that was with pretty much every day wear.
